Refugees, individuals who have been forced to flee their homes due to persecution, conflict, or natural disasters, often face a myriad of challenges when they seek asylum in a new country. These challenges can range from finding employment and housing to accessing education and healthcare. On the other hand, host countries struggle to effectively integrate refugees into their societies while also managing the economic and social implications of large numbers of displaced people. This is where artificial intelligence comes into play. AI technologies have the potential to revolutionize the way we approach issues related to refugee resettlement and integration. For example, AI-powered chatbots can provide refugees with 24/7 access to information and support services, helping them navigate the complexities of their new environments. AI algorithms can also be used to match refugees with job opportunities that align with their skills and experiences, increasing their chances of successful integration and self-sufficiency. Additionally, AI can assist host countries in better managing the influx of refugees and optimizing the allocation of resources. By analyzing data on refugee populations and their needs, AI systems can help governments and humanitarian organizations make more informed decisions about where to allocate funding, housing, and other essential services. AI-powered predictive models can also anticipate trends and potential challenges, enabling proactive responses to emerging issues. However, the use of AI in the context of refugees is not without its concerns. Critics argue that AI technologies may perpetuate biases and inequalities, potentially disadvantaging already vulnerable populations such as refugees. There are also ethical considerations surrounding the collection and use of refugee data, raising questions about privacy and consent.
